Steam over a medium - hot heat for at least 20 minutes depending on the size and numbers of crab. Start timing once the water is boiling again. The crabs should turn a bright red or orange colour when done. Remove the crabs and rinse under cold water, which will also stop the cooking process.

Cooked crab meat can be frozen and will keep for four months.

Throw away the stomach sac, mouth, intestines and the gills and then scoop and scrape out the brown meat. You may want to crack open and split the body into two or four parts to access the meat more easily. Then go back to the legs and claws. Crack the claws and split the legs and remove the succulent white meat. Place live crabs in freezer for approximately 15 minutes to numb them prior to cooking. Find your largest stock pot and fill it with water. Salt the water, heavily, and add 3 bay leaves, a tablespoon or so of whole black peppercorns, and a teaspoon of paprika.

Do not put the crab into iced water as this will cause it to become waterlogged. Crab is often dressed with mayonnaise and lemon juice and served with bread and butter. Dressed crab is a great addition to salads and sandwiches too. White crab meat is beautifully light and sweet and complements a host of fresh spring and summer flavours such as cucumber , tomato and mackerel.

The white meat also works brilliantly in crab cakes — Shaun Rankin looks to Asia with his Crispy crab, sweetcorn and coriander fritters while Vineet Bhatia has created a South Indian crab cake with crab chutney.
